About the Role

The Sr Marketing Operations Specialist is a marketing professional who will play a vital role in supporting and optimizing our marketing technology stack, executing campaigns, maintaining data hygiene, and ensuring smooth operational alignment across the marketing function. As a key member of Engine's Marketing Operations team (under the Revenue Operations division), you will partner closely with marketing, sales, and the rest of the revenue operations team to drive exceptional execution of growth initiatives and pipeline growth.

Responsibilities
  • Campaign Operations: Set up, test, and deploy marketing campaigns, including email, webinars, and events using our marketing automation platform (Customer.io). This includes building and coding emails using HTML and Liquid code.
  • Data Management: Maintain accuracy and cleanliness of marketing data within Salesforce and Customer.io; manage lead capture, enrichment workflows, and routing using Clay and Cargo.
  • Technology Support: Administer, optimize, and troubleshoot our core marketing technology stack, including Customer.io (email automation), Salesforce (CRM), Clay and Cargo (data enrichment and activation), and Tray.io (workflow automation).
  • Reporting & Analytics: Support monthly and ad hoc marketing performance reporting, campaign analysis, and dashboard management.
  • Process Improvement: Document and help streamline processes for campaign operations, lead management, and attribution.
  • Automation Management: Build, manage, and optimize automation workflows in Tray.io that support both PLG and sales-led motions, including lead routing, lifecycle triggers, and cross-system data syncs.
  • Cross-functional Collaboration: Partner with growth, sales, and revenue operations to align on campaign execution, pipeline quality, and programs impact.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
